HC Deb 19 July 1982 vol 28 c78W
Mr. Foulkes

asked the Secretary of State for Scotland what action he is taking to increase the percentage of disabled persons employed by the Scottish Office and the Scottish prison service from 1.6 per cent. and 0.4 per cent., respectively, to the level of 3 per cent. specified in the Disabled Persons (Employment) Act.

Mr. Younger

The officers in my Department and in the Departments responsible for recruitment are fully aware of the Government's policy on the employment of registered disabled persons, and work closely with the specialist staff of the Manpower Services Commission. Many war-disabled employees have reached retirement age and there are severe limitations on the employment of disabled persons in the prison service, where the nature of the work demands, in most posts, a high standard of physical fitness.
